This is my first post,so please bear with me,I'm building a 1985 Chevy Crewcab Dually from the ground up.I;m building a 454 for it,it has a Turbo 400 in it now,its geared 4:10,I need overdrive!Any thought or ideas?As inexpensive as possible,I plan on towing a gooseneck horse trailer with it and my jeep as well.Not at the same time,lol.thanx for the advice.

I personally think it would be cheaper to go with 3:73 gears in the rear end, you'll get close to the same results, but if your bent on a tranny, try to find a 4l80E. It will cost more, but will last longer. 1 4l80e is cheaper than 2 700r4s
-
But the 4L80E requires a stand alone controller. If you could find a 90-91 TBI 454 setup with 4L80E you could upgrade the trans and the injection system. My 1991 CREW has this but with a 350 and gets 17mpg on the highway.
